WBRZ to Broadcast High School Football Special
WBRZ will broadcast “Friday Night Blitz Preseason Special”, an hour high school football show, beginning at 7pm on Friday, August 21, 2009.
The “Friday Night Blitz Preseason Special” will cover high school football teams across South Louisiana. WBRZ Sports 2 will give you their picks for which schools they think will play for state championships. The show will break down the local districts and preview more than 50 area schools fighting their way to the dome.
This special will replay on sister station WBTR, which airs on Cox 19 and over-the-air on Channel 41. Viewers should check their local cable companies to see if WBTR is carried in their area. Viewers should also check for additional rebroadcast dates and times. Below is the date and time of the first rebroadcast:
- Saturday, August 22, 2009 4 - 5pm
In addition to this special, WBRZ will broadcast “Friday Night Blitz” every Friday night during high school football season. Each show will consist of highlights from around the area, coach’s interviews and a recap of the week’s winner of the WBRZ Fans’ Choice Award. The first broadcast for the regular season show is Friday, August 28th at 10:35pm.
The “Friday Night Blitz Preseason Special” will be hosted by WBRZ Sports Director Michael Cauble, weekend anchor Chad Sabadie and reporter Kristen Eargle.
